A. Czirok et al., EXPERIMENTAL-EVIDENCE FOR SELF-AFFINE ROUGHENING IN A MICROMODEL OF GEOMORPHOLOGICAL EVOLUTION, Physical review letters, 71(13), 1993, pp. 2154-2157
An experimental evidence for kinetic roughening in a micromodel of mou
ntain ranges is presented. We have observed that during the watering o
f an initially smooth ridge made of a mixture of silica sand and earth
y soil the surface, evolves into a shape analogous to actual mountain
profiles with self-affine geometry. For the exponents describing respe
ctively the temporal and the spatial scaling of the surface width beta
almost-equal-to 0.9 and alpha=0.78 +/- 0.05 have been obtained. The l
atter value is in very good agreement with alpha=0.8 +/- 0.1 we have c
alculated for genuine transect profiles.
